Musetti's Strengths and Weaknesses

Let's put Musetti under the microscope, shall we? Lorenzo Musetti's strengths lie primarily in his incredible shot-making ability and court coverage. He's known for his elegant strokes, particularly his one-handed backhand, which is a thing of beauty. He can generate angles that leave opponents guessing, and he's not afraid to mix things up with drop shots and slices. Musetti's versatility allows him to adapt his game to different surfaces and opponents. He’s also got a good net game, showing off his all-court skills. Tactical Analysis: How They Match Up

Alright, now for the fun part – how do these guys match up tactically? When Musetti plays Sinner, we see a fascinating clash of styles. Musetti will try to disrupt Sinner's rhythm with his variety and creative shot-making. He'll look to use drop shots, slices, and angles to pull Sinner out of position. He'll try to force Sinner to make errors and take control of the net whenever possible.

On the other hand, Sinner's strategy typically involves playing with depth and power, aiming to wear Musetti down with his relentless consistency. He'll look to exploit any weaknesses in Musetti's game, such as his occasional lapses in concentration. Sinner will try to control the tempo of the match and dictate points with his powerful groundstrokes. He'll put pressure on Musetti by targeting his backhand and moving him around the court.
